Hi All,
I'm trying to enable Audit Log capabilities in my Model Driven App and after enabling auditing in my environment, I noticed audit logs still weren't being kept. I double checked my tables in my DEV environment and confirmed that I did in fact Enable Auditing in the specific tables, but then when I imported the solution, I came to find that the box wasn't checked in PROD. Any ideas as to how to get my audit choice to persist across environments?
DEV Environment:
PROD Environment:
Doing this on a Managed solution creates a layer. This is not a solution.
Hi @apol3
The auditing needs to be enabled at three levels:
1. Environment (manually in each downstream environment where you want it enabled)
2. Table/Entity (manually or through solution deployment)
3. Column/Field (manually or through solution deployment)
From your response, it appears that number 2 was missed but I'm glad you were able to figure it out.
Kind regards
Gulshan
Ok so Dataverse works in mysterious ways sometimes... I didn't really answer my question as to why that choice doesn't persist, but did find a way to enable the Audit Log in PROD
1. From the App itself, click the Settings gear and go to "Advanced Settings"
2. Click the Settings Dropdown and Choose System -> Administration
3. System Settings -> Auditing
4. Choose "Entity and Field Audit Settings"
5. Use the Classic Navigation to click to your entities and check off the Audit box (it's in the "General" tab)
WarrenBelz
791
Most Valuable Professional
MS.Ragavendar
410
Super User 2025 Season 2
mmbr1606
275
Super User 2025 Season 2